Output 2880229aca4a4e2442655ff1eb88211b4bd55217bee5862a8a8b1db7dfaadee8:0

value
67342200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ae3fe76dc111a0f24178d9fdb4a69392ad722e30 OP_EQUAL
address
3HaN43vo45FPFKcc4HuTWREYZDCas92Jte
transaction
2880229aca4a4e2442655ff1eb88211b4bd55217bee5862a8a8b1db7dfaadee8
confirmations
320410
spent
true